/*NOTE: This file is intended for programmers. Aspro technical support is not advised to work with him.*/

/* Examples (uncomment to use):*/

/* Expand site width */
/* body .wrapper { max-width: 1400px !important;  } */

/* Set site background image */
/* body {  background: url(image_source) top no-repeat; }

/* Hide compare button */
/* a.compare_item { display: none !important;  }*/


.price-current {
font-weight: 700;
}

.header__title_opt {
color: #ffffff;
}

.price__new {
font-weight: 400;
color: #8D8D8D;
}
.nudges {
  width: 100%;
  margin-top: 20px;
}
.nudges__items {
  display: grid;
  grid-template-columns: 50% 50%;
  gap: 10px;
}
.nudges__item {
  padding: 10px 20px;
  background-color: #A58057;
  display: flex;
  align-items: center;
  justify-content: center;
  color: #ffffff;
  font-weight: 700;
  border-radius: 5px;
}

/*--------------------------------------------------------------
Catalog block item

Правил: german-web.org
Дата: 20.05.25
--------------------------------------------------------------*/
.catalog-block__item-v2 {
    padding: 0;
    overflow: hidden;
    --catalog-block-padding-bottom: var(--catalog-block-padding);
}

.catalog-block__item-v2 .side-icons {
    top: 8px;
    right: 8px;
}

.catalog-block__item-v2 .image-list-wrapper img {
    border-radius: 0;
    margin: unset;
    height: 100%;
}

.catalog-block__item-v2 .image-list .toggle-white-grey-bg {
    --toggle-bg: transparent;
}

.catalog-block__item-v2 .catalog-block__inner>div {
    padding: 0 var(--catalog-block-padding) 0 var(--catalog-block-padding);
}

.catalog-block__item-v2 .catalog-block__inner>div:last-child {
    padding-bottom: var(--catalog-block-padding-bottom);
}

.catalog-block__item-v2 .catalog-block__inner .js-config-img,
.catalog-block__item-v2 .catalog-block__inner .image-list {
    padding: 0;
}

.catalog-block__item-v2 .section-gallery-nav {
    bottom: -12px;
}

.catalog-block__item-v2 .catalog-block__info {
    margin-top: 24px;
}

@media screen and (max-width: 600px) {

    .grid-list.grid-list--compact .js-popup-block.catalog-block__item-v2,
    .catalog-block__item-v2 {
        padding: 0;
    }

    .catalog-block__item-v2 {
        --catalog-block-padding: 12px;
        --catalog-block-padding-bottom: 8px;
    }

}

@media screen and (max-width: 450px) {
    #main .grid-list.grid-list-v2 {
        gap: var(--gap);
    }
}

/*--------------------------------------------------------------
End of Catalog block item
--------------------------------------------------------------*/

/*--------------------------------------------------------------
Catalog grid

Правил: german-web.org
Дата: 26.05.25
--------------------------------------------------------------*/
.catalog-items > .catalog-block > .grid-list {
    --theme-items-gap: 4px;
}

@media (max-width: 600px) {
    #main .mobile-scrolled:not(.grid-list--no-gap),
    .catalog-items > .catalog-block > .grid-list {
        --gap: min(var(--theme-items-gap), 2px);
    }
    .maxwidth-theme {
      --theme-page-width-padding: 2px;
    }
}

/*--------------------------------------------------------------
End of Catalog grid
--------------------------------------------------------------*/


/*--------------------------------------------------------------
Search block

Правил: german-web.org
Дата: 09.06.25

--------------------------------------------------------------*/
.btn-search.btn[disabled] {
    border: unset !important;
    opacity: 0.4;
    pointer-events: none;
    transition: all .4s;
}

.search-page-form input[type="submit"]:disabled  {
    opacity: 0.4;
    pointer-events: none;
    transition: all .4s;
}
/*--------------------------------------------------------------
End of search block
--------------------------------------------------------------*/


/*--------------------------------------------------------------
Order status

Правил: german-web.org
Дата: 19.06.25
--------------------------------------------------------------*/
.order__pay-status,
.order-pane__col .order__bar,
.personal__wrapper .filter-panel__main-info [data-name="by_payed"],
.order__info__status.order__shipment-status
 {
  display: none;
}
/*--------------------------------------------------------------
End of order status
--------------------------------------------------------------*/
